Address 0 DOGE

DMUBrHde3Q3NaVf7PpacBKxBeDdYqyVZLx

Confirmed

Total Received143.29970275 DOGE
Total Sent143.29970275 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ions

DMUBrHde3Q3NaVf7PpacBKxBeDdYqyVZLx143.29970275 DOGE
Fee: 0.15993513 DOGE
170519 Confirmations143.13976762 DOGE